The most typical type of window frame for double-glazed windows is u, PVC (unplasticised polyvinyl chloride, to provide it its full name).

Many individuals feel wooden windows look better and more subtle than u, PVC, especially in standard or period-style residential or commercial properties. While timber windows tend to be more pricey and require upkeep, they can last a very long time if properly looked after. Aluminium is a really strong material, so its windows are resilient and low upkeep.

Outdoor patio moving doors, frequently described as simply patio area doors or moving doors, are glass doors that slide open. Typically one relocations while the other stays fixed, but you can have both moving.
